Job Summary
DRS NPS has an immediate need for a highly technical Engineering Manager. This highly-visible leadership position has two primary responsibilities.
First, to provide functional management and technical leadership to a team of 10-15 engineers within a matrixed organizational structure. Second, this role is expected to lead challenging and innovative technical projects, with the ability to be an effective bridge between engineering, other functions, and senior management.
In the functional manager role, this position will be responsible to manage resources in support of large number of active development programs. This role baselines individual expectations, performs performance evaluations, provides performance-based feedback, career development, resource/skill gap assessments, and hiring recommendations.
This role also monitors and manages the performance of the team through development and evaluation of metrics, including reporting up to senior management. Additionally, this role is expected to drive engineering efficiencies through continuous improvement efforts.
In the technical leader role, this position is responsible for estimating, planning, and driving technical execution of U.S. military and customized commercial projects ranging from $2M - $150M+. The day-to-day focus entails organizing, leading, and encouraging multidisciplinary project team(s) ranging from 3-10+ engineers, as well as direct individual contributions to project work.
Critical to success in the role is the ability to organize complicated technical challenges, inspire the engineering team to find innovative solutions to problems, and clearly document/present project status within the team, to project leadership, and to other functions (including senior management).
As part of regular activities, this role will have significant supplier and customer interaction.
Ideal Candidate
The ideal candidate is an individual possessing strong mechanical and/or electrical engineering skills, combined with engineering team leadership skills. The ability to set a vision for a team and influence its adoption is a key skillset.
